What is a payroll operations platform?

A payroll operations platform is the layer that manages everything around payroll calculation: the workflows, client communication, data capture, approvals, scheduling and tracking. Rather than calculating pay itself, it sits around your existing payroll software to bring structure, visibility and control to the end-to-end payroll process. Changepen is a payroll operations platform built specifically for payroll bureaus and accountancy firms.

What is the difference between payroll software and a payroll operations platform?

Payroll software calculates and processes pay, tax, deductions and submissions. A payroll operations platform manages everything around that calculation: how changes are collected from clients, how work flows through your team, how progress is tracked, and how risks are flagged. Changepen is the operations platform, and it works alongside your payroll software rather than replacing it.

How does Changepen reduce payroll errors?

Most payroll errors come from missed instructions, manual re-keying and last-minute changes. Changepen reduces them by capturing client changes in a structured format, keeping every instruction and approval logged and auditable, and giving teams clear workflows so steps are not missed. Catching issues before payroll is finalised is far cheaper and less stressful than correcting them afterwards.
